PG – Marcus Paige: Paige saw a drop in scoring production from his sophomore to junior year, but did increase his assist/game. As the point guard and floor general, UNC is in very good shape with Paige announcing his return for his senior season.
SG – Theo Pinson: Although Pinson was out for most of his freshman season because of a foot injury, UNC fans saw a glimpse of the five-star potential he provides. Expectations are still high for Pinson, an athletic guard, who’s currently slated as a 1st rounder in Draft Express’ 2016 draft.

SF – Justin Jackson: Johnson showed during the NCAA tournament that he is one of the most deadly players in the country when his jumper is on. Needs to improve on his rebounding/assist numbers, but expect his 10.7 points a game to go up next year. Has the potential to be a lottery pick.
PF – Brice Johnson: Johnson made huge strides from his sophomore to his junior season and cemented himself as one of college basketball’s best rebounders. A forward combo of Johnson and Meeks looked terrific throughout the year for the Tar Heels.
C – Kennedy Meeks: The only ‘true’ back-to-the-basket player on UNC’s roster, Meeks, like Johnson, developed into a terrific player last year for Carolina. Averaging 11.4 points and 7.3 rebounds, Meeks will be one of, if not the best center in the ACC next season.
Bench rotation: 6) Nate Britt 7) Isaiah Hicks 8) Joel Berry 9) Luke Maye (Brandon Ingram? Jaylen Brown?)

The issue with this team likely will be the same as it was with last year group – there doesn’t appear to be a great shooter on the roster. Even with the potential shooting struggles, the likely departure of J.P. Tokoto and potentially not landing Brown or Ingram, UNC is in very good shape to make a Final Four run next season.
